Gold for Nadal

Wimbledon champion Rafael Nadal is now Olympic champion after beating Chile’s Fernando Gonzalez 6-3 7-6 6-3 to win the men’s tennis gold. It is Spain’s first ever gold in tennis and Nadal is the first player ranked in the top five to win the title.
